Storytelling Shoes: Artist transforms shoes into sculptures that tell a tale
Before you throw out those old shoes, consider the work of Greek born Israeli artist Costa Magarakis, who loves to transform different footwear into sculptures that tell their own stories.

From former skating shoes and high heeled wedges to sporty trainers and big boots – Costa's imagination runs wild, taking inspiration from Victorian inventions and classical fiction. You can almost imagine them leaping from the pages of a Jules Verne novel.
Alas, you can't actually don Costa's creations. They are made of reinforced stone hard resin or high quality fibreglass and aren't wearable. However, you can purchase a sculpture of your own, as he sells his one-of-a-kind pieces via Etsy. To find out more, visit www.costamagarakis.com.
